What kinds of information can forensic anthropologists gather from human skeletal remains?
Forensic Anthropologists
Specialists who apply anthropological methods and techniques to assist in legal investigations, particularly in identifying human remains.
Skeletal Remains
The framework of bones left after other parts of the body have decayed away, often used in the context of archaeology and forensics.
